Enlarged blossom or bud...Schizomyia viburni Felt
This species is known from a female "about to oviposit in flowers," but Felt (1918a, 1940) associates it with an unspecified bud gall. An enlarged flower gall is made by another Schizomyia on Sambucus, so S. viburni may come from enlarged flowers if not buds as well. Host: Viburnum sp. Distr.: New York.
